Output 38612017f77a18c4f5d615b5d45c28ddb974cfc20ba2868e2cf7d68dd1c213d4:1

value
6968358
script pubkey
OP_0 OP_PUSHBYTES_20 e3c13cec53345ed7dacf4f086f2559d87e192162
address
bc1qu0qnemznx30d0kk0fuyx7f2emplpjgtzcnajnu
transaction
38612017f77a18c4f5d615b5d45c28ddb974cfc20ba2868e2cf7d68dd1c213d4
confirmations
164686
spent
true